And finally, the nature of Portugal. There were peacocks at São Jorge Castle next to olive trees hundreds of years old whose bark had become almost stone like. Fiddler crabs, seaweed, and clams on the beaches of Sintra and hibiscus at botanical gardens.

The details of Portugal. From tiles scattered around the cobblestone streets of Lisbon to the glint of freshly poured Port to a pair of smiles from newlyweds celebrating life, Portugal offered everything one could hope for in a vibrant, destination expedition.

The grandeur of Portugal. From the vast expanse of the North Atlantic to the Medieval cityscapes of Porto and the terraced vineyards of the Douro Valley. For a country the size of Maine, everything in and surrounding Portugal can seem unimaginably grand.
